My early dinner was a Twisted Steakhouse Salad. I’ve been craving one of those spinach-mushroom-egg with hot bacon vinaigrette salads that places like Ale House serve but only had the mushrooms and egg in my fridge and didn’t feel like stinking up the house with bacon….so I sauteed some mushrooms and purple onion then wilted in some torn green leaf lettuce. I plated that then fried an egg (I broke the yoke, sad…sad) sat it up on top and drizzled it all a bit with some of my dessert quality balsamic (it’s actually the only kind I buy, can you say Yum?).
